Note, this forum discusses the microprocessor Teensy. Typically sound cards made for normal computers won't work on the Teensy. Since you didn't mention which sound card you are planning to use or whether you've programmed Teensys before, it is hard to say whether it would work or not.
That being said, you can make light sabers with Teensys. There is a company that sells the parts and software to make your own light saber:
If you wanted a more DIY approach, you could presumably build one with a Teensy 3.2, prop shield with motion sensor, some LED sticks (either neopixels/ws2812b or dotsarts/apa102), and a speaker:
That being said, if you are starting out fresh, it will probably be a tough slog to learn everything (programming, soldering, etc.). However, the only way to learn is to start. You probably want to start with easier things and work your way up to a lightsaber.
